Depreciation

Iron Mountain Depreciation decreased by 3.2% to $192.13M in Q1 2026 compared to the prior quarter. Year-over-year, this metric grew by 18.3%, from $162.44M to $192.13M. Over 4 years (FY 2021 to FY 2025), Depreciation shows an upward trend with a 12.0% CAGR.

How to read this metric

High depreciation relative to revenue may indicate a capital-intensive business model or significant recent investment in infrastructure.
